All 4 accused in Telangana Vet’s rape and murder case killed in police encounter

All the four accused in the Hyderabad veterinarian gang rape and murder case have been killed in a police encounter with Telangana police early on Friday.

The police said the four accused were taken to the crime scene, when they allegedly attempted to flee and were shot at. The encounter took place on the NH-44 near Hyderabad — the same highway where the charred body of the 26-year-old was found.

As per initial reports, the four accused had been taken to the spot for recreation of the crime scene, when they were shot dead by the police while trying to escape.

The post-mortem of the accused will be conducted at Mahbubnagar district hospital. Hyberabad Commissioner VC Sajjanar has confirmed that all of the four accused were killed between 3 AM and 6 AM at Chatanpally near Shadnagar.

The four accused were arrested and were in judicial custody and lodged in high-security cells at Cherlapally Central Jail in Hyderabad.

Meanwhile, the father and sister of the victim expressed their happiness over the death of the accused in the hands of police. According to them, justice has been meted out.

The charred body of the 26-year-old woman, working as an assistant veterinarian at a state-run hospital, was found under a culvert in Shadnagar area of Hyderabad on November 28, a day after she went missing.
